sdcard: a program to create a "virtual" /sdcard pointed at a path
sdcard is a program that uses FUSE to emulate FAT-on-sdcard style
directory permissions (all files are given fixed owner, group, and
permissions at creation, owner, group, and permissions are not
changeable, symlinks and hardlinks are not createable, etc.
usage: sdcard <path> <uid> <gid>
It must be run as root, but will change to uid/gid as soon as it
mounts a filesystem on /sdcard. It will refuse to run if uid or
gid are zero.
